When you send a document without VAT to myDATA, you must also fill in the VAT exemption reason (vatExemptionCategory). You pick from the menu of VAT Code articles that provide an exemption.

Under the new VAT Code (Law 5144/2024), many article numbers changed compared with the old Code (Law 2859/2000). The myDATA code 1–31 did not change — only the label text did.

The table below summarises what each article covers so you can pick the right reason when issuing. It is not tax advice — if unsure, ask your accountant.

VAT exemption reasons table

How to read the table: the Code (1–31) is what you send to myDATA and stays the same. The Old law (Law 2859/2000) column shows the old article in the label. The New law (Law 5144/2024) column shows the new article for the same reason. The last column explains briefly when to use it. Where the two law columns match, the article number did not change.

Code Old law (Law 2859/2000) New law (Law 5144/2024) When / meaning
1 Without VAT – article 2 and 3 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 2 and 3 of the VAT Code Scope of VAT / taxable person. Use for out-of-scope acts (e.g. compensation for material damage, income from participations, subsidies/grants) and for the Mount Athos special regime.
2 Without VAT – article 5 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 5 of the VAT Code Transfer of a business as a whole, a branch or part of it (for consideration, free of charge, or as a contribution to a legal entity). Not treated as a supply of goods → no VAT.
3 Without VAT – article 13 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 17 of the VAT Code Place of supply of goods outside Greece: goods already abroad at sale, assembly/installation abroad, sales on ships/aircraft/trains during an intra-EU journey, assignment of import rights, etc.
4 Without VAT – article 14 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 18 of the VAT Code Place of supply of services outside Greece: e.g. consulting/accounting/legal with a customer outside Greece, services related to immovable property abroad, passenger transport outside Greece, catering abroad, admission to events abroad, electronic services with a customer outside Greece. For OSS to private customers in other Member States see also code 30.
5 Without VAT – article 16 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 21 of the VAT Code Chargeability timing. When the invoice is issued later than VAT becomes chargeable and an “Special document for VAT purposes on intra-EU transactions” is issued at that earlier time.
6 Without VAT – article 19 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 24 of the VAT Code Taxable amount — special cases: returnable packaging deposits; newspapers/magazines; telecom cards; tickets.
7 Without VAT – article 22 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 27 of the VAT Code Domestic exemptions: medical/hospital care, social welfare, education/sports, insurance and banking, property rentals and first-home sales, supplies without VAT deduction right, sales by associations/foundations at fundraising events, etc.
8 Without VAT – article 24 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 29 of the VAT Code Export outside the EU (and equivalent acts) and international transport: exports to third countries/territories outside the EU customs territory; services directly linked to exports (transport, brokerage, etc.).
9 Without VAT – article 25 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 30 of the VAT Code International movement / special customs regimes: customs warehousing, customs storage, inward processing, etc.
10 Without VAT – article 26 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 31 of the VAT Code Tax warehouses (not customs): supplies / intra-EU acquisitions for entry into the regime and related services; also acts inside the warehouse while goods stay in the same regime (not production/manufacture).
11 Without VAT – article 27 of the VAT Code Without VAT – article 32 of the VAT Code Special exemptions of article 32 other than codes 12/13: diplomacy/consulates, international organisations / EU / ECB, NATO, needs of refugees/vulnerable groups, State donors, etc. Prefer 12 for seagoing vessels; 13 for fuel/stores.
12 Without VAT – article 27 – Seagoing Vessels of the VAT code Without VAT – article 32 – Seagoing Vessels of the VAT code Supply/import of vessels for open-sea navigation and materials incorporated in them. Usually hull length ≥ 12 m and activity mainly on the open sea.
13 Without VAT – article 27.1.c – Seagoing Vessels of the VAT code Without VAT – article 32.1.c – Seagoing Vessels of the VAT code Fuel, lubricants, stores and other provisioning goods for specific vessels/craft/aircraft. More specific than 11; use with 12 for seagoing vessels.
14 Without VAT – article 28 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 33 of the VAT code Intra-EU supplies: goods dispatched/transported to another Member State to a taxable person (or non-taxable legal person) with a VAT number of another Member State notified to the supplier.
15 Without VAT – article 39 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 44 of the VAT code Small-business scheme: annual turnover (excl. VAT) for the previous and current year up to about €10,000. On documents: “without VAT – small business exemption”.
16 Without VAT – article 39a of the VAT code Without VAT – article 45 of the VAT code Reverse charge (VAT paid by the customer): recyclable waste; greenhouse-gas emission allowances; certain public works; mobiles, game consoles, tablets and laptops, etc.
17 Without VAT – article 40 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 47 of the VAT code Flat-rate schemes: coastal fishing vessels up to 12 m and sponge divers; vessels on Lake Ioannina; horse-drawn vehicles.
18 Without VAT – article 41 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 48 of the VAT code Farmers special scheme: e.g. agricultural supplies/services under about €15,000 and subsidies under about €5,000 in the previous year. They do not charge VAT on their supplies.
19 Without VAT – article 47 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 54 of the VAT code Investment gold: supply / intra-EU acquisition / import; and brokerage acting in the name and on behalf of another on investment-gold supplies.
20 VAT included – article 43 of the VAT code VAT included – article 50 of the VAT code Travel agents (margin): VAT only on the agency’s gross margin and only for the part of the trip within the EU — not on the full package price.
21 VAT included – article 44 of the VAT code VAT included – article 51 of the VAT code Manufactured tobacco: taxable amount = retail price excl. VAT. Tax is embedded in the price; indication “VAT not deductible”.
22 VAT included – article 45 of the VAT code VAT included – article 52 of the VAT code Dealers in used goods / works of art / collectors’ items / antiques: VAT on the resale margin (gross profit).
23 VAT included – article 46 of the VAT code VAT included – article 53 of the VAT code Auction sales: special taxable-amount rules (usually on the organiser’s commission/margin).
24 Without VAT – article 6 of the VAT code Without VAT – article 8 of the VAT code Supplies of immovable property that are not taxable acts (e.g. buildings permitted before 1.1.2006) and supplies under VAT suspension.
25 Without VAT – POL.1029/1995 Without VAT – POL.1029/1995 Supplies to Duty-Free Shops (KAE): a KAE exemption duplicate voucher is required; the supplier’s document must show the related exemption indication.
26 Without VAT – POL.1167/2015 Without VAT – POL.1167/2015 EDDA procedure: purchase/import of goods for export or intra-EU supply and related services. The buyer/importer issues a Special Duplicate VAT Exemption Voucher to the supplier or Customs.
27 Other VAT Exceptions Other VAT Exceptions Only if no other reason fits. Use carefully — almost all cases are covered by codes 1–26 and 28–31.
28 Without VAT – article 24 para. b’ par.1 of the VAT Code, (Tax Free) Without VAT – article 29 para. b’ par.1 of the VAT Code, (Tax Free) Tax Free retail to travellers: goods in personal luggage; traveller not established in the EU; goods leave the EU before the end of the third month after the month of supply.
29 Without VAT – article 47b, of VAT code (OSS non-EU regime) Without VAT – article 56 of the VAT Code (OSS non-EU regime) OSS non-Union: non-EU established service providers to non-taxable persons in Greece or another Member State; VAT number with prefix “EU”.
30 Without VAT – article 47c, of the Code VAT (OSS EU status) Without VAT – article 57 of the VAT Code (OSS EU status) OSS Union: intra-EU distance sales, supplies via electronic interfaces, and services by an EU-established taxable person not established in the Member State of consumption — mainly e-shop to private customers in other Member States and B2C services taxed in another Member State.
31 Without VAT – article 47d of VAT Code (IOSS) Without VAT – article 58 of the VAT Code (IOSS) IOSS: distance sales of goods imported from third countries/territories in consignments with intrinsic value up to €150 (excluding excise goods); VAT number with prefix “IM”.

Tips

  • The code (1–31) stays the same; do not renumber EMDI mappings only because the article in the label changed.
  • For seagoing vessels prefer 12; for fuel/stores 13; keep 11 for the other special exemptions of the same article.
  • Avoid code 27 (Other VAT Exceptions) if a more specific reason exists.
  • For Tax Free, code 28 is usually used.
  • For services to private customers in other Member States via OSS, see code 30 (not only code 4).
